          • #6
            oem is 18x7.5et38. i believe some are made by OZ and some made by Ronal... they came with 225/40 from factory
            reps are NORMALLY 18x8et35, so nicer specs then oem.
            i cant imagine you could get custom made specs without specing silly $$ (sorts of $$ you could buy decent wheels such as rotiform or 1552)
